Transaction 93cc6f7140d53dab330ca53ee1e4ff3fdee022390660ad96e6e0bf2163bae1e7
1 Input
1 Output
-
93cc6f7140d53dab330ca53ee1e4ff3fdee022390660ad96e6e0bf2163bae1e7:0
- value
- 427006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5ecfe9974768cb97acc0be03c427b25d741130c OP_EQUAL
- address
- 3KjYx182GTWi9yyfkUKMmxUtZXbeiD5ab1